Keep up with everything you care about in one place with Feeder (www.feeder.co). Feeder is the RSS reader and news manager that tracks any online source you choose and bundles it into an easy-to-digest reading experience. Have any questions? We're always listening at support@feeder.co The best RSS Feed Reader extension for Chrome. - Instantaneously see when new posts are added to one of your RSS and Atom feeds - Easily subscribe to new RSS/Atom feeds by clicking the browser icon - Intuitively manage your feeds - Right click context-menus in popup-menu let you mark all as read, reload feeds, and other nifty shortcuts - Export your feeds so you can import them on another computer and/or keep them as backups for safekeeping - Customize your feeds by choosing how many posts to display, or changing the title - Organize your feeds using folders and sorting with drag and drop - Choose between two different themes: Dark or Light - Everything is contained within the browser so no other third-party sites are needed - Notifications when feeds have been updated. Enable globally or on select feeds - Supports both RSS and Atom feeds - See when a page has any RSS or Atom feeds to subscribe to - Sound notifications - Mobile apps Collect and organize content like a Pro, subscribe to Feeder Plus or Professional (more information on feeder.co) - 1 minute updates - Filters, rules and collections If you have any feedback, bugs or issues, we're always listening on our support channel: support@feeder.co. If any RSS or Atom feeds don't work please report it to us. Brought to you by Really Simple AB from Stockholm, Sweden, the RSS Feed Reader team. Have fun with RSS and Atom! Changelog: V8.0.26: Fix bug playing YouTube videos on feeder.co V8.0.25: Fix bugs introduced in 8.0.24 V8.0.24: Fixes for Chrome Dev release V8.0.23: Fix some sites not working in Full mode V8.0.22: Optimises how push notifications are received and fixes a bug where unread counts would double when displaying notifications V8.0.21 fixes an issue that prevented the subscribe page loading on some RSS feeds V8.0.20 - Added date format settings local to your language - Handle RTL languages better - Follow OS theme by default V8.0.1 through V8.0.19 Fixes bugs and inconsistencies from the previous major release. The goal of V8 is to be compatible with Chrome's Manifest V3 changes. This required a complete rewrite of the codebase. In the process we tweaked the interface to be slightly easier to read, and also adds more customisation options. If things you relied on previously don't work anymore, please let us know at support@feeder.co. We're listening! V8.0.0 This version is a complete rewrite to support new latest Manifest V3 platform.
